Apple iPad Air (2019)
iPadOS 15.2
1. Find "Other ..."
Press Settings.
![](http://wmstatic.global.ssl.fastly.net/ml/7151223-f-1da713de-70af-4cbb-99fd-3017994e121b.png?width=306&height=408)
Press Mobile Data.
![](http://wmstatic.global.ssl.fastly.net/ml/7151223-f-209f8a4c-c9c8-48c4-aac8-0f539d108b72.png?width=306&height=408)
Press Add a New Plan.
![](http://wmstatic.global.ssl.fastly.net/ml/7151223-f-09724f49-168b-46a9-8255-d39471e0a9d8.png?width=306&height=408)
Press Other ....
![](http://wmstatic.global.ssl.fastly.net/ml/7151223-f-2ddcc567-2fd2-475d-bb9e-daed0b56cedd.png?width=306&height=408)
2. Scan QR code
Place the QR code you've received inside the tablet camera frame to scan the code. If you’ve deleted your eSIM, you can re-add it using your existing QR code. If you’re having problems, see our FAQ.
![](http://wmstatic.global.ssl.fastly.net/ml/7151223-f-33dfcc9f-ba56-44fb-9462-32eed9b120c7.png?width=306&height=408)
3. Activate eSIM
Press Add Data Plan.
![](http://wmstatic.global.ssl.fastly.net/ml/7151223-f-b6922284-59a0-48a3-bf71-980700a42366.png?width=306&height=408)
4. Return to the home screen
Press the Home key to return to the home screen.
